About This Item

New York: Charles Scribner's Sons, 1973 WYSIWYG pricing--no added shipping charge for standard shipping within USA. Black cloth, illustrated endpapers, xi, 531 pp. Notes in pen on a couple of pages, else VG, corners bumped. Front flap only of DJ is laid in. Contains: a brief article on each work including synopsis, where and when first published in England and U. S., in some cases how the work came to be written; an alphebetical list of characters, with description, quote, name of work, and in some cases a cross-reference (e.g., Dawkins, John is cross-referenced as Artful Dodger, The); a similar, but much shorter, list of places; a time line of Dickens's life, career, and general events; an alphabetical list of Dickens's circle, with partial capsule biographies; a long (241 pp) section of quotations; and an index.
